Denver, CO (August 25, 2026) – At least one person was injured on Sunday afternoon, August 23, in a crash involving two motorists near West Florida Avenue and South Tennyson Street. The collision was reported at approximately 3:47 p.m.
The initial alert confirmed that two motorists were involved and that injuries were reported. Authorities continue reviewing the circumstances surrounding the crash.

Why Side and Angled Collisions Can Cause Serious Trauma
When two vehicles collide near an intersection, occupants may be exposed to front, side, or angled impacts depending on traffic flow. Even a relatively brief impact can cause sudden movement inside the cabin.
The head, neck, back, chest, and limbs can all be affected by crash forces. Seat belts and airbags may reduce the risk of injury, but they cannot prevent all types of trauma.
Travel speed, impact angle, seating position, restraint use, and vehicle structure can all influence injury severity. Some symptoms may also develop gradually after the collision rather than appearing immediately.
